Hailing from the musical breeding grounds of Orange County, CA, metalcore band Bleed the Sky began in 2003 with vocalist Noah Robinson, guitarists Kyle Moorman and Wayne Miller, bassist Casey Kulek, sampler Luke Andersen and drummer Austin D’Amond. Merely two months later and ready to dive into the music scene, the group performed their first show to a sold out crowd in an opening spot for Opeth and their second headlining the world famous Whisky A Go Go.

Early the following year their first EP, Bleed the Sky, was produced by Ben Schigel, known for his work engineering and mixing great music with groups such as Ringworm, Chimaira, and Walls of Jericho. The band sold over 1,000 copies on their own before signing a deal with Nuclear Blast Records in the fall of 2004. Their April of 2005 debut for the label, Paradigm in Entropy (2005), featured a futuristic, industrial, and melody-infused take on nu-metal’s dissonant riffs and aggressive vocals.

The album cemented the band as a forerunner in the New Wave of American Heavy Metal movement of the mid 2000’s and allowed for many opportunities and shows, including a consistent rotation on MTV’s Headbanger’s Ball. Their major success allowed them to tour with the likes of Hatebreed, Soulfly, Napalm Death, Red Chord, Agnostic Front, Disturbed, Diecast, and ILL Nino, only further promoting their albums and musical talent over the years.

Following the release of two well received albums with Nuclear Blast Records, Paradigm in Entropy (2005), and Murder the Dance (2008), they once again aimed to redefine who they are with a new label, Art Is War Records. The releases of This Way Lies Madness (2020) and the single “The Devil Will See You Now” (2020) started to gain the band massive online attention with the single reaching over a million streams on Spotify.

Not letting the pandemic keep them down for long, Bleed the Sky has returned with the same intensity that fans of their previous albums will be familiar with, as well as a new brutality that they are excited to share with the metal community. In 2022, Monte Barnard joined the group as the new frontman and was eager to bring his talent and experience to an already versatile group.

Getting his start in Northern California’s Death Metal scene, Monte Barnard joined Alterbeast in 2014 and continued his work touring and filling in on vocals with such bands as Thy Art Is Murder, The Kennedy Veil, and Fallujah. He still also fronts Emberthrone on Seek & Strike Records, as well as Lesser Animal.

Armed with a new vocalist and the release of a new single, “The Parasite” featuring guest vocalist Mark Hunter from Chimaira, they are set to make a mark once more in the music world and enthrall the masses with vigor.

The group is currently composed of Monte Barnard on Vocals, Kevin Garcia on Guitar, Wayne Miller on Guitar, David Culbert on Bass and Austin D’Amond on Drums.

Norwegian Jazz trio, BUSHMAN’S REVENGE, whose music mixes the energy of Rock with the freedom of Jazz in a way that is exciting and exhilarating, have inked a deal with Is it Jazz? Records for the release of their eleventh full-length album.
 
Formed in 2003, BUSHMAN’S REVENGE’s lineup of Even Helte Hermansen on Guitar,  Rune Nergaard on Bass, and Gard Nilssen on Drums, have had two decades in which to explore different paths and sounds, and, in doing so, they have succeeded in creating a genre all of their own.

With 10 critically acclaimed albums under their belts, and over 300 live appearances throughout the world, BUSHMAN’S REVENGE have earned a fearsome reputation, with Jazzwise commenting that they are “Insanely good! As if Jeff Beck was backed by Elvin Jones“, whilst David Fricke of Rolling Stone said that they were “Like a Marshall amp version of John Coltrane’s “Interstellar Space“
 
In addition to the new album, this year also marks their 20th anniversary as a band, and having been described as one of the most exciting live bands out there,  well known for their explosive energy and telepathic interplay, fans can expect a lot of celebrating on the part of BUSHMAN’S REVENGE in the coming months!
 
BUSHMAN’S REVENGE’s new album will be titled “All The Better For Seeing You”, and full details regarding its release will be revealed shortly.

Progressive music icon CYNIC will be embarking on an extensive North American co-headlining tour with ATHEIST! The trek will launch on June 10 in Austin, TX and will conclude on July 9 in Greensboro, NC. The full run of dates can be found below and tickets will go on sale Friday, April 28!

CYNIC be celebrating the 30th anniversary of ‘Focus’ by performing the seminal album in its entirety while also paying homage to late members Sean Reinert and Sean Malone.

Later in the year, CYNIC will then perform at the illustrious ProgPower USA festival on September 6 in Atlanta, GA!

The new live lineup will feature Paul Masvidal on vocals and guitars, Max Phelps (Exist, Death to All) on additional guitars and vocals, Brandon Giffin (The Faceless, The Zenith Passage) on bass, Matt Lynch (Nova Collective, Intronaut) on drums & percussion, and Zeke Kaplan on the keyboard! Lynch has been drumming with CYNIC since 2015 & appeared on the band’s latest full-length, ‘Ascension Codes,’ as well as the 2018 single “Humanoid.” Additionally, Phelps, having also appeared on ‘Ascension Codes,’ and Giffin have previously toured with CYNIC during the band’s ‘Carbon Based Anatomy’ and ‘Kindly Bent to Free Us’ tours.

CYNIC founding member Paul Masvidal comments, “Come join us for a night of Cynic/Atheist magic! We’ll be celebrating our lifelong journey together with a night of progressive music and timeless memories. Don’t miss it!”

ATHEIST‘s Kelly Schaefer adds, “This has been something that Paul (Cynic) and I have been talking about in some capacity since we were in our early 20s. It’s surreal to share a 30 year milestone together, and this tour will showcase for us a chance to play songs from our first 3 records as a special trilogy anniversary set,  including songs not performed live in decades. Two titans of technical progressive metal coming together for a unicorn of a tour….one you will not want to miss!”

Upon reissuing ‘Darkspace I,’ ‘II,’ and ‘III,’ the enigmatic black metal band is now reissuing ‘-I’ and ‘III I’ as well! ‘-I’ (EP 2012) and ‘III I’ (LP 2014) will be released on vinyl with new artwork on June 9, 2023 via Season of Mist.

The albums have been out of print for some time, and are long awaited by fans of the band. The CD’s of Darkspace I, II, III, -I and III I were previously released on February 17, 2023.

Pre-orders are available HERE.

DARKSPACE was founded by Wroth, Zorgh and Zhaaral in 1999 in Berne (Switzerland). In two decades four albums and an EP were released: Dark Space -I to Dark Space III I. The band rarely appeared live. In 2019, Zorgh quit while the band was awarded the Music Prize of the Canton of Berne for the creation of their soundscapes and their atmospheric performances. In 2022, Yhs joined Wroth and Zhaaral to complete the three again. Far on the horizon outlines of a new release are emerging.

UK’s most exciting new talent, alt-metal outfit VEXED, emerged as one of the hottest new bands to watch in heavy music. After their highly-lauded debut in 2021 the crushing Hertfordshire unit will unleash the album’s aggressive successor, entitled Negative Energy, on June 23rd via Napalm Records. Heavier and more violent, the new studio album depicts the confidence VEXED have gathered since their first release, and represents a soundtrack of brutality – chaotic, traumatic and based on the band’s most grueling personal experiences.

Crushing new single “Anti-Fetish” comes as the first harbinger and fearlessly breaks in with an all-consuming, panic-stricken lead riff, making a stand against comparisons and hate in the business. Blistering with disorderly intensity, VEXED don’t mince words with pure honesty and all-consuming instrumental strength. The brand-new official music video underlines this message in a visually impressive way that captivates from start to finish!

VEXED on “Anti-Fetish” :
“We wanted to start with a huge riff and a strong message. Anti-Fetish is us confronting the constant comparisons and ungrounded hate that bands receive. It’s become completely accepted in the scene to cross the line of constructive criticism and just dive bomb into hatred and prejudice. This song is us setting the record straight by calling out the blatant discrimination.”

Negative Energy achieves pinnacle musicianship and gripping, profound and brave lyricism. Instead of opting for forced positivity like many of their contemporaries, the Hertfordshire three-piece channel every ounce of their Negative Energy into these 13 tracks – recharging themselves for an uphill battle. 

The band states:            
“We are so proud to present to you our second album. Since our first release, we have each endured traumatic experiences, surrounded by death, betrayal, pain and grief. In order to find any strength, we first had to accept that we weren’t okay, then take our trauma and face it head on, sharing our vulnerability, fears and weaknesses. Instead of forcing ourselves to try and be positive we put all our negative energy into the album in order to begin our own repair and to overcome.”

Haunting intro track “PTSD” sets a stage of dread for the carnage to come. “We don’t talk about it” – featuring pitch-shifted verses emulating a disguised voice – explores childhood trauma and survivor’s guilt. “X my ❤ (Hope to die)” deals with what happens after we die and that it should be okay to never get this answer, while “Panic attack” centers on mental health issues, representing terror and frustration through heavy riffs and grooving vocals. Furious “Lay down your flowers” (feat. Alpha Wolf vocalist Lochie Keogh) showcases extreme vocals and bombarding drums, while disturbingly groovy following track “There’s no place like home” draws inspiration from ‘The Wizard of Oz’. The unbelievably heavy “Extremist” gets straight to the point, kicking off with fast and demanding vocal rhythms, while “Default”, on the other hand, displays multifaceted lead singer-to-watch Megan Targett’s high-soaring clean vocals juxtaposed against her menacing deep growls. This is equally evident on standout, dynamic “Trauma Euphoria”, also featuring some of the most impressive guitar work on the album. The album’s most emotional offering, “It’s Not The End”, serves as a magnificent dedication to a loved one passing away while manifesting their legacy, before sliding into instrumental interlude “DMT” – cradled by lo-fi beats with hints of 808, delivered in fresh VEXED style. Intense album finale “Nepotism” wraps up Negative Energy with a knot of rage before slowly fading out into darkness. Negative Energy proves itself as a stunning, devastating musical conduit – ventilating the band’s pain-stricken burdens and breathing life into their fresh approach, delivered with a vengeance.

Finland’s melodic metal act WEIGHTLESS WORLD released earlier this year an ambitious and actor filled music video with their single Initiate Restart. Now, the five-piece group has again released new material: Speedrun is a heads-on metal song about perseverance.

“The origin of the song is actually a Drum and Bass track I was experimenting with. That track ended up also remaining as an experiment, but I saved the main lead in the intro as I thought that it would make a much better metal song. While tracking the demos, we got inspired by a style of “modern Swedish metal arrangement” as we like to call it and ended up finishing the song only in couple of hours while having fun and embracing many clichés”, says the bassist Tino Kantoluoto.

Speedrun is, as the name suggests, a fast-paced song, but it still contains a few twists. The drummer Kari Rannila was not inquired about his preferences for the tempo, as the song BPM was rather just announced:

“The boys just told me ‘sorry about the tempo of this’ when they presented the song to me. Otherwise it has power and a great catchy chorus, but I really need to get my legs working for it” Rannila laughs.

Guitarist Valtteri Viinikka praises the lead vocalist Perttu Korhonen for his vocal performance in the studio and also the lyrics he wrote. Inspired by the infamous video game Dark Souls, the lyrics portray the perseverance in many levels:

“From grinding in a video game to a modern day real-life grind on working towards what you want. I would love to hear the song in a sports event or even have it as an entrance song for an athlete or a team before a match” says Viinikka.

Weightless World’s debut album the End of Beginning was released in 2019. The next full length album is set to release next Fall.
